*Cities of Iran* offers a comprehensive and vibrant journey through Iran's diverse urban landscape, from its ancient origins as a cradle of civilization to its modern-day metropolises. This insightful book explores how geography, history, and culture have intricately shaped over two dozen key cities, revealing their unique characters, economic drivers, and enduring legacies. Delve into the rich tapestry of Persian civilization, discovering the grandeur of imperial capitals, the spiritual solace of pilgrimage sites, the industrious heart of economic powerhouses, and the ingenious resilience of desert oases.
Each chapter provides a detailed portrait of a major city or region, such as Tehran's bustling modernity, Isfahan's artistic masterpieces, Shiraz's poetic gardens, Mashhad's spiritual transformation, and Yazd's harmonious adaptation to the desert. The book highlights iconic landmarks like the UNESCO World Heritage sites of Naqsh-e Jahan Square and the Bam Citadel, alongside the vibrant bazaars, unique culinary traditions, and diverse ethnic communities that define each urban center. It showcases Iran's dynamic blend of ancient history, profound cultural heritage, and rapid contemporary development.
Beyond historical exploration, *Cities of Iran* delves into the present-day realities, addressing the challenges of rapid urbanization, environmental concerns, and the opportunities for sustainable growth. It paints a picture of a nation in constant dialogue with its glorious past and rapidly unfolding future, where traditional craftsmanship thrives alongside burgeoning industries.
